The Department: Core Industries:
The Core Industries business unit is responsible for the growth of key markets including rail, industrial equipment, healthcare, truck and renewable technologies. This division supports around half of the company’s Global business, with many complex products, challenging projects and strong customer base. These markets are a vital stream within the UK, and there are currently many premium and “blue chip” companies and supporting supply chain key customers.
The Role:
This is a field-based position, traveling at least 3-4 days a week, ideally close to the existing customer base, but with broader responsibility for developing assigned accounts across Northern England and Scotland.
You will manage extensive business relationships with customers at all levels of the supply chain, to further drive our growth and profitability.
Focusing on key growth markets, you will use your technical, commercial and sales knowledge to sell products offering to existing and new business.
With full support from the Business Manager, the successful candidate will look for opportunities in different industries, prospecting for new business, be familiar with working with customers to develop technical, engineered solutions and solve problems, contributing to our ambitious growth targets.
The position would ideally suit an individual who is already employed in a sales capacity or somebody wanting to develop their career in sales. Either way, candidates must demonstrate a good level of commercial acumen, familiar with working with customers to develop bespoke solutions and resolving problems.
